Leadership Review Briefing — Divestiture of the Coastal Logistics Unit. Sales leads should note that Harwell Group has agreed in principle to acquire our Coastal Logistics unit, pending diligence scheduled through next quarter. Customer accounts will transfer in phased tranches, and commission structures remain unchanged until close. Please avoid speculative conversations with clients until the communications pack is issued. The rationale and timing are summarised in the confidential note below.

management briefing: Project Ulavan slips by two quarters because of the staffing delay.

Ticket #2087 — Digest scheduler can't reach the queue DB

Heads up for on-call: the Nightjar batch email digests have been failing since around 02:00. The scheduler throws connection-refused errors when it tries to claim the next batch window, so digests are piling up unsent. Retries are exhausting after five attempts and the dead-letter queue is growing fast. We suspect the pool config got clobbered in last night's deploy. To check queue depth and manually release stuck batch locks, connect to the scheduler database using the string below.

replica DSN, kajep-yahag: mssql://praok_svc:iF@db-8d68.plorvaio.local:5432/eliion

Key ceremony checklist, item 7 — Driftpost webhook signing. Rotate the parcel-tracking webhook signing key in the Halloway console, confirm both old and new keys accept deliveries during the 24-hour overlap, then retire the old key. Verify at least one live tracking event validates against the new signature before closing the ticket. If the console locks you out mid-ceremony, the escrow terminal will unseal with the recovery passphrase written directly below this item.

strongbox words: wenix-ulador

Quarterly Planning Note — Divestiture of the Coastal Tooling Unit

For the finance team: the sale of the Coastal Tooling unit to Pellmark Industries remains on track for close in Q3. Please finalize the carve-out balance sheet, reconcile intercompany positions, and prepare the working-capital adjustment schedule by month-end. Audit support requests should be prioritized. For planning purposes, note the following sensitive item:

internal memo for hawef-kahif: The finance team signed off on a budget of $25.9 million for Project Sorox. The renewal with Pelokek Logistics closes at $51.7 million a year, 52 percent below the last contract.